Accel Telecom Launches First Standalone Connected Car Smartphone

TEL AVIV, Israel, February 18, 2013 /PRNewswire/ --

VOYAGER connects drivers easily, clearly and safely

Accel Telecom, a leading Israeli telecommunications company, has officially launched VOYAGER, the ultimate Connected Car Smartphone device. VOYAGER is the first standalone...
